Brandon VW internet sales department quoted me a great price on a new car. I emailed them several times to be sure the price and car was all worked out. Brandon VW sent me a written quote and I put a deposit on what should have been my new car. I secured financing via my bank, picked up a cashiers check, and then called the dealer to let them know that I was on the way. They said that the car was ready for pick up and I headed to Brandon. 20 minutes later the dealer called and said they had made a mistake on the price and they were unable to sell me the car for that price. I informed them that I had a written quote and had just spoken with steve, I also let them know that I had already left work early to pick up the check. The dealer told me that they had made a pricing mistake and the car would cost me $1000 more that what we agreed on. The practice of getting a consumer to commit to a car, passing on other offers, taking there deposit and then switching the deal 20 minutes before arrival is deplorable. I have never attempted to shop at a business that operated with so little integrity. Beware of this dealership and there business practices. More

I wanted this to be a very positive review, and up until the moment we saw our certified pre-owned car, everything had been going perfectly: After finding what seemed like the perfect car online through a s the moment we saw our certified pre-owned car, everything had been going perfectly: After finding what seemed like the perfect car online through a salesman named Steve at Brandon VW, we had put down a deposit and flown in. When we asked about potential condition issues with the car, Steve had promised us that it was in pristine shape and reminded us that the car had a 2 year warranty. Steve delivered a final "out the door" price in writing, promising that we would come down and pick up a perfectly detailed car with a full tank of gas. We came down with our cashier's check in hand certain we'd be getting a used car that was in perfect condition. Unfortunately, there were a number of cosmetic issues that were not disclosed either by Steve in his numerous conversations on the phone or on the online ad: two 6" scrapes where the paint was entirely removed, a cracked taillight cover, stained upholstery, and the radio antenna was missing. The car had not been detailed - there was a wad of gum stuck to the back of one seat, and when we turned it on, we discovered only 1/3 of a tank of gas. Worst of all, the final bill of sale came in $500 too high. We asked Steve for help, expecting that the salesman who had appeared trustworthy and helpful on the phone would fix the "mistake". Steve took care of the over-charge (after we insisted and showed that we had his written offer in writing) andvery reluctantly offered to replace the cracked tail light cover (though he hasn't mailed it to us yet, and we aren't holding our breath) and told my husband that he had "done all he could for us" and promptly disappeared. No hand shake, no apology, no gas, no nothing. When we couldn't find him, we talked to a manager about the antanna and he replaced it on the spot with no fuss. We were left with a very uneasy feeling wondering what else was wrong with the car. We were extremely disappointed with Steve and would NEVER recommend Brandon VW to anyone. More
